Market Drivers
The global influence of the "Hallyu" cultural wave is a significant driver for the Makgeolli market, as the mainstream success of Korean entertainment and cuisine introduces the rice wine to Western audiences. The United States has become a key growth area, with the Korea Agro-Fisheries & Food Trade Corporation reporting that annual exports to the U.S. reached USD 2.76 million in February 2025, reflecting a 7.9% year-over-year increase. As noted by the Maeil Business Newspaper in February 2025, the U.S. is now the second-largest export destination, marking a crucial shift from regional Asian trade to a wider international footprint.Complementing this cultural momentum is strategic government support aimed at reducing regulatory burdens and incentivizing artisanal production. Policymakers have implemented fiscal reforms to treat traditional liquor as a high-value export, with the Chosun Ilbo reporting in February 2025 that tax benefits were expanded by doubling the eligible production limit to 1,000 kiloliters annually. These measures are designed to help small and medium-sized brewers scale up and modernize, thereby addressing logistical inefficiencies and fostering a competitive export-oriented manufacturing base.
Market Challenges
The primary obstacle hindering the Global Makgeolli Market is the logistical complexity and high cost associated with maintaining strict cold-chain standards for fresh, unpasteurized products. Because fresh Makgeolli retains active yeast and continues to ferment after bottling, it risks spoiling or exploding if not kept at consistently low temperatures, compelling exporters to use expensive air freight or specialized refrigerated containers. This economic burden renders the distribution of authentic products unviable for many long-distance markets that lack adequate cold-chain infrastructure.Consequently, these logistical barriers restrict market penetration by limiting the availability of high-quality fresh products to geographically proximate regions, preventing the sector from fully capitalizing on global interest in Korean gastronomy. The severity of this constraint is evident in trade data; the Korea Customs Service reported that in 2023, the total export volume of Makgeolli and traditional rice wines decreased by 9.2 percent to approximately 13,982 tons. This contraction demonstrates how logistical hurdles effectively cap international expansion and stifle volume growth despite broadening consumer awareness.
Market Trends
The market is being reshaped by the proliferation of fruit-infused and dessert-like flavors, moving beyond traditional profiles to attract the "MZ Generation." Breweries are aggressively launching varieties with aromas such as chestnut, yuzu, and Earl Grey to modernize the beverage's image and appeal to younger consumers seeking novel options. This strategy has successfully revitalized domestic demand; The Korea Times reported in May 2024 that BGF Retail saw a 14.2 percent year-on-year increase in flavored Makgeolli sales, with consumers in their 20s and 30s accounting for nearly 70 percent of these purchases.Simultaneously, exclusive collaborations with convenience stores have emerged as a dominant distribution strategy, transforming retail chains into influential brand incubators. Major operators are partnering with craft breweries to release limited-edition, private-label products that leverage sophisticated logistics to reach both domestic and international consumers. According to the Maeil Business Newspaper in March 2025, this channel-led expansion is driving significant volume, with GS Retail’s export revenue exceeding USD 9 million in 2024, largely attributed to the global popularity of these collaborative products.
